It's Not Just About Living Longer
Most of us don't simply want more years. We want to remain strong, clear-headed, mobile and independent as we get older. That's the idea behind healthspan.
At ReWell, longevity starts with the individual. Your health history, lifestyle, environment, goals and priorities are different from someone else's, so there isn't one protocol that makes sense for everyone.
The foundations still matter — nutrition, strength and movement, sleep, stress, recovery and lifestyle — but they can be considered alongside personalised health information and, where appropriate, functional testing, health technology and additional longevity and recovery strategies.
Rather than chasing every new longevity trend, the focus is on understanding where you are now, what matters most to you and which changes or interventions are genuinely worth prioritising.
Healthspan
What Are We Trying to Protect?
Longevity isn't one thing — it's a combination of the factors that let you keep doing what matters to you, for longer.
Brain & Cognitive Health
Supporting the lifestyle foundations associated with maintaining cognitive health, focus and mental performance as we age.
Heart & Metabolic Health
Building healthier nutrition, movement and lifestyle habits that support cardiovascular and metabolic wellbeing.
Strength & Mobility
Maintaining muscle, strength, balance and physical capacity so you can keep doing the things that matter to you.
Sleep & Recovery
Improving the habits and routines that support restorative sleep and everyday recovery.
Energy & Resilience
Looking at the factors within your nutrition, lifestyle and recovery that can influence energy and overall wellbeing.
Personal Health Insights
Using relevant health information and, where appropriate, testing or technology to help inform more individual decisions.
